Prospective Risks and Side Effects



When considering cold laser treatment, it is necessary to be familiar with the prospective dangers and side effects related to this therapy. While cold laser treatment is normally thought about risk-free, there are a few possible negative effects to bear in mind.

Some individuals may experience light discomfort throughout the therapy, such as a mild prickling sensation or warmth in the targeted location. In unusual instances, skin irritation or inflammation at the website of therapy might take place.

Furthermore, there's a small risk of eye injury if the laser is routed in the direction of the eyes. It's vital for both the person and the professional to wear safety eyeglasses during the treatment to avoid any kind of unintentional exposure to the eyes.

Additionally, cold laser treatment shouldn't be done over locations with energetic malignant lumps or on people who are expecting, as the effects of the therapy in these cases aren't well recognized.

Safety And Security Considerations for Details Groups



Consider the safety and security considerations for specific groups when undergoing cold laser therapy to ensure ideal therapy results.

Expecting individuals must prevent cold laser therapy straight on the abdominal area or reduced back, particularly during the first trimester, to prevent any prospective damage to the creating fetus.

Individuals with a background of skin cancer or skin disease that make them much more conscious light need to consult with a healthcare provider before going through cold laser treatment, as it may worsen their condition.

Individuals with a pacemaker or other dental implanted digital gadgets ought to inform their healthcare provider prior to treatment, as the laser's electromagnetic radiation could possibly hinder these gadgets.

Those with epilepsy ought to also exercise caution, as the blinking light from the laser may activate seizures in some people.

Additionally, people taking photosensitizing medications must be aware that cold laser therapy could boost their sensitivity to light, potentially leading to damaging responses.
